提交 3484af4c 编写于 作者: Z zhongning5

feat:add Error Code Description on js-apis-system-parameterEnhance

Signed-off-by: Nzhongning5 <zhongning5@huawei.com>
上级 834f053d
...@@ -37,6 +37,17 @@ getSync(key: string, def?: string): string ...@@ -37,6 +37,17 @@ getSync(key: string, def?: string): string
| -------- | -------- | | -------- | -------- |
| string | 系统参数值 <br> 若key存在,返回设定的值。 <br> 若key不存在且def有效,返回def;若未指定def或def无效(如undefined),抛异常。 | | string | 系统参数值 <br> 若key存在,返回设定的值。 <br> 若key不存在且def有效,返回def;若未指定def或def无效(如undefined),抛异常。 |
**错误码**
| 错误码ID | 错误信息 |
| -------- | ------------------------------------------------------------ |
| 14700101 | System parameter can not be found. |
| 14700102 | System parameter value is invalid. |
| 14700103 | System permission operation permission denied. |
| 14700104 | System internal error including out of memory, deadlock etc. |
以上错误码详细介绍请参考[errorcode-system-parameterV9](../errorcodes/errorcode-system-parameterV9.md)
**示例:** **示例:**
```ts ```ts
...@@ -63,6 +74,17 @@ get(key: string, callback: AsyncCallback&lt;string&gt;): void ...@@ -63,6 +74,17 @@ get(key: string, callback: AsyncCallback&lt;string&gt;): void
| key | string | 是 | 待查询的系统参数Key。 | | key | string | 是 | 待查询的系统参数Key。 |
| callback | AsyncCallback&lt;string&gt; | 是 | 回调函数。 | | callback | AsyncCallback&lt;string&gt; | 是 | 回调函数。 |
**错误码**
| 错误码ID | 错误信息 |
| -------- | ------------------------------------------------------------ |
| 14700101 | System parameter can not be found. |
| 14700102 | System parameter value is invalid. |
| 14700103 | System permission operation permission denied. |
| 14700104 | System internal error including out of memory, deadlock etc. |
以上错误码详细介绍请参考[errorcode-system-parameterV9](../errorcodes/errorcode-system-parameterV9.md)
**示例:** **示例:**
```ts ```ts
...@@ -96,6 +118,17 @@ get(key: string, def: string, callback: AsyncCallback&lt;string&gt;): void ...@@ -96,6 +118,17 @@ get(key: string, def: string, callback: AsyncCallback&lt;string&gt;): void
| def | string | 是 | 默认值。 | | def | string | 是 | 默认值。 |
| callback | AsyncCallback&lt;string&gt; | 是 | 回调函数。 | | callback | AsyncCallback&lt;string&gt; | 是 | 回调函数。 |
**错误码**
| 错误码ID | 错误信息 |
| -------- | ------------------------------------------------------------ |
| 14700101 | System parameter can not be found. |
| 14700102 | System parameter value is invalid. |
| 14700103 | System permission operation permission denied. |
| 14700104 | System internal error including out of memory, deadlock etc. |
以上错误码详细介绍请参考[errorcode-system-parameterV9](../errorcodes/errorcode-system-parameterV9.md)
**示例:** **示例:**
```ts ```ts
...@@ -135,6 +168,17 @@ get(key: string, def?: string): Promise&lt;string&gt; ...@@ -135,6 +168,17 @@ get(key: string, def?: string): Promise&lt;string&gt;
| -------- | -------- | | -------- | -------- |
| Promise&lt;string&gt; | Promise示例,用于异步获取结果。 | | Promise&lt;string&gt; | Promise示例,用于异步获取结果。 |
**错误码**
| 错误码ID | 错误信息 |
| -------- | ------------------------------------------------------------ |
| 14700101 | System parameter can not be found. |
| 14700102 | System parameter value is invalid. |
| 14700103 | System permission operation permission denied. |
| 14700104 | System internal error including out of memory, deadlock etc. |
以上错误码详细介绍请参考[errorcode-system-parameterV9](../errorcodes/errorcode-system-parameterV9.md)
**示例:** **示例:**
```ts ```ts
...@@ -167,6 +211,16 @@ setSync(key: string, value: string): void ...@@ -167,6 +211,16 @@ setSync(key: string, value: string): void
| key | string | 是 | 待设置的系统参数Key。 | | key | string | 是 | 待设置的系统参数Key。 |
| value | string | 是 | 待设置的系统参数值。 | | value | string | 是 | 待设置的系统参数值。 |
**错误码**
| 错误码ID | 错误信息 |
| -------- | ------------------------------------------------------------ |
| 14700102 | System parameter value is invalid. |
| 14700103 | System permission operation permission denied. |
| 14700104 | System internal error including out of memory, deadlock etc. |
以上错误码详细介绍请参考[errorcode-system-parameterV9](../errorcodes/errorcode-system-parameterV9.md)
**示例:** **示例:**
```ts ```ts
...@@ -195,6 +249,16 @@ set(key: string, value: string, callback: AsyncCallback&lt;void&gt;): void ...@@ -195,6 +249,16 @@ set(key: string, value: string, callback: AsyncCallback&lt;void&gt;): void
| value | string | 是 | 待设置的系统参数值。 | | value | string | 是 | 待设置的系统参数值。 |
| callback | AsyncCallback&lt;void&gt; | 是 | 回调函数。 | | callback | AsyncCallback&lt;void&gt; | 是 | 回调函数。 |
**错误码**
| 错误码ID | 错误信息 |
| -------- | ------------------------------------------------------------ |
| 14700102 | System parameter value is invalid. |
| 14700103 | System permission operation permission denied. |
| 14700104 | System internal error including out of memory, deadlock etc. |
以上错误码详细介绍请参考[errorcode-system-parameterV9](../errorcodes/errorcode-system-parameterV9.md)
**示例:** **示例:**
```ts ```ts
...@@ -233,6 +297,16 @@ set(key: string, value: string): Promise&lt;void&gt; ...@@ -233,6 +297,16 @@ set(key: string, value: string): Promise&lt;void&gt;
| -------- | -------- | | -------- | -------- |
| Promise&lt;void&gt; | Promise示例,用于异步获取结果。 | | Promise&lt;void&gt; | Promise示例,用于异步获取结果。 |
**错误码**
| 错误码ID | 错误信息 |
| -------- | ------------------------------------------------------------ |
| 14700102 | System parameter value is invalid. |
| 14700103 | System permission operation permission denied. |
| 14700104 | System internal error including out of memory, deadlock etc. |
以上错误码详细介绍请参考[errorcode-system-parameterV9](../errorcodes/errorcode-system-parameterV9.md)
**示例:** **示例:**
```ts ```ts
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册